什么是默认虚拟主机?
卡尔云官网
www.kaeryun.com
好,我现在需要回答用户的问题:“什么是默认虚拟主机”,用户希望我以知乎风格,结合专业知识,用大白话写一篇至少1000字的文章,并且优化SEO,突出关键词。
我得理解什么是默认虚拟主机,默认虚拟主机是Web应用服务器上自动分配的虚拟主机,用户访问网站时会自动跳转到这里,它通常由服务器管理软件,比如Apache或Nginx配置,自动创建。
我需要解释这个概念,让读者明白它是什么,以及它在Web开发中的作用,可能需要提到虚拟主机的作用,比如隔离环境,避免影响其他应用。
我应该详细说明配置默认虚拟主机的过程,包括访问控制、日志记录、安全设置等,这些都是用户关心的安全方面。
比较不同的虚拟主机服务,比如Cloudflare、AWS、阿里云,说明它们各自的优缺点,帮助用户选择适合自己的。
总结一下默认虚拟主机的重要性,强调它的便利性和安全性,鼓励用户正确配置和管理。
在写作时,要使用大白话,避免专业术语过多,同时穿插例子,让内容更生动易懂,确保文章结构清晰,逻辑流畅,符合SEO优化,关键词如“默认虚拟主机”、“Web应用服务器”等要自然出现。
我需要组织这些思路,确保文章内容全面,同时保持口语化,让读者容易理解。
在Web开发中,我们经常听到“默认虚拟主机”这个词,但很多人可能对它不太了解,默认虚拟主机就是Web应用服务器上自动分配的一个虚拟主机,当你访问网站时,浏览器会自动跳转到这里。
举个例子,假设你有一个网站叫example.com,但你还没有把它配置到服务器上,服务器可能会自动分配一个默认虚拟主机,比如example.com自动跳转到localhost,或者分配一个随机的域名,比如123example.com,这时候,你访问example.com就会跳转到这个默认的虚拟主机上。
默认虚拟主机的作用主要是隔离Web应用环境,当你在开发一个Web应用时,服务器可能会分配一个默认的虚拟主机,这个虚拟主机只允许访问你的应用,而不影响其他应用或服务器上的资源,这样可以避免因配置错误或误操作导致的资源冲突或数据泄露。
默认虚拟主机还负责一些基本的安全功能,比如访问控制、日志记录和权限管理,服务器管理软件会自动配置这些安全功能,确保只有授权的用户或应用程序能够访问你的网站。
让我们详细了解一下默认虚拟主机的配置和管理,默认虚拟主机的配置需要通过Web服务器管理软件来完成,比如Apache、Nginx或IIS,这些服务器管理软件会自动创建默认虚拟主机,并根据配置文件设置访问权限和安全措施。
在Apache服务器中,你可以通过php.ini
文件或access.log
文件来配置默认虚拟主机的访问规则,在Nginx中,可以通过配置文件或URL重写规则来实现同样的功能,配置完成后,服务器会将访问请求自动跳转到默认虚拟主机上,而不是直接跳转到你的域名。
有些虚拟主机服务商会提供默认虚拟主机的管理工具,方便用户进行配置和管理,Cloudflare提供默认虚拟主机的自动分配和管理功能,而AWS和阿里云的服务器管理工具也提供了类似的配置选项。
需要注意的是,虽然默认虚拟主机有一定的默认配置,但很多企业会根据自己的需求进行自定义,可以设置访问权限、限制访问IP地址、启用SSL证书等,这些配置可以通过服务器管理软件的配置文件或控制面板来实现。
默认虚拟主机是一个非常重要的概念,尤其是在Web开发和服务器管理中,它不仅帮助我们隔离Web应用环境,还提供了基本的安全功能,了解如何配置和管理默认虚拟主机,可以大大提高我们的开发效率和安全性。
如果你对默认虚拟主机还有疑问,或者想了解更多关于Web服务器管理的知识,可以参考一些专业的文档或参加相关的培训课程,希望这篇文章能帮助你更好地理解默认虚拟主机的作用和配置方法。
卡尔云官网
www.kaeryun.com